A double glass bifacial module is similar to a basic bifacial module but with a key difference: it has glass on both the front and back sides. This means that the entire module is enclosed in glass.

Solar street lights can work for 2 to 7 rainy days depending on battery size and panel quality. Quality monocrystalline solar panels capture more sunlight even on cloudy days.
